## Markdown pipeline stall — Inkmoor renderer

If the Inkmoor render queue backs up, first check the sanitizer stage: oversized tables can wedge a worker without raising an error. Drain the stuck worker, requeue its batch, and confirm throughput recovers within two minutes. Do not restart the whole pipeline unless draining fails. When escalating, cite the deployed build's token, which appears below.

build token for yagug-kafog: htk31_e462130c366caae6ce4c8057e0f2196

To the release manager: I'm passing ownership of the Pellwick deep-link router to Sorrel before the 4.2 cut. The intent-matching table now lives in the Farrowgate config service; stale entries were purged last sprint. Watch the fallback route — it silently swallows malformed slugs, which inflated our drop-off metrics in March. The staging resolver needs its keystore unlocked before each regression pass, and that keystore accepts only one credential. For the signing vault, the recovery phrase is noted directly below.

recovery phrase for tafog-fafog: novix-novdor-fraath-brieth-olieth-oliix-rusix-wenion-julax-druox

Escalation for per-tenant rate quotas (Quotaline service): if a tenant reports throttling they didn't expect, first check the quota dashboard — most cases are a stale plan sync, fixed by re-running the entitlement job. If quotas look correct but throttling persists, it's probably the limiter cache; don't restart it yourself. Ping the platform on-call, and if nobody answers within 15 minutes, escalate by mail.

pager mailbox: drudor@tolvaqworks.corp